Induced Pluripotent Stem Cells
Cells generated from adult cells that have been reprogrammed to an embryonic-like state, capable of developing into different types of cells.
Homeotic Factors
Genes that regulate the development of anatomical structures in various organisms, ensuring that body parts form in the correct locations.
Mouse Fibroblasts
A type of cell derived from mice that is prevalent in connective tissue, playing a significant role in wound healing and tissue repair.
Drosophila Melanogaster
A species of fruit fly used as a model organism in genetics and developmental biology research.
